diff --git a/client/homebrew/editor/metadataEditor/metadataEditor.jsx b/client/homebrew/editor/metadataEditor/metadataEditor.jsx index d16d7556b..3d77f557f 100644 --- a/client/homebrew/editor/metadataEditor/metadataEditor.jsx +++ b/client/homebrew/editor/metadataEditor/metadataEditor.jsx @@ -37,7 +37,7 @@ const MetadataEditor = createClass({ renderer : 'legacy', theme : '5ePHB' }, - onChange : ()=>{}, + onChange : ()=>{}, reportError : ()=>{} }; }, diff --git a/client/homebrew/editor/snippetbar/snippetbar.less b/client/homebrew/editor/snippetbar/snippetbar.less index 2947837bd..57f868899 100644 --- a/client/homebrew/editor/snippetbar/snippetbar.less +++ b/client/homebrew/editor/snippetbar/snippetbar.less @@ -1,4 +1,4 @@ - +@import (less) './client/icons/customIcons.less'; .snippetBar{ @menuHeight : 25px; position : relative; @@ -104,6 +104,7 @@ i{ margin-right : 8px; font-size : 1.2em; + height : 1.2em; &~i{ margin-right: 0; margin-left: 8px; diff --git a/client/icons/customIcons.less b/client/icons/customIcons.less new file mode 100644 index 000000000..f41a2fc83 --- /dev/null +++ b/client/icons/customIcons.less @@ -0,0 +1,15 @@ +.fac { + display : inline-block; +} +.position-top-left { + content: url('../icons/position-top-left.svg'); +} +.position-top-right { + content: url('../icons/position-top-right.svg'); +} +.position-bottom-left { + content: url('../icons/position-bottom-left.svg'); +} +.position-bottom-right { + content: url('../icons/position-bottom-right.svg'); +} diff --git a/client/icons/position-bottom-left.svg b/client/icons/position-bottom-left.svg new file mode 100644 index 000000000..eb0709d8e --- /dev/null +++ b/client/icons/position-bottom-left.svg @@ -0,0 +1 @@ + \ No newline at end of file diff --git a/client/icons/position-bottom-right.svg b/client/icons/position-bottom-right.svg new file mode 100644 index 000000000..f9cb7250a --- /dev/null +++ b/client/icons/position-bottom-right.svg @@ -0,0 +1 @@ + \ No newline at end of file diff --git a/client/icons/position-top-left.svg b/client/icons/position-top-left.svg new file mode 100644 index 000000000..d8240d2a8 --- /dev/null +++ b/client/icons/position-top-left.svg @@ -0,0 +1 @@ + \ No newline at end of file diff --git a/client/icons/position-top-right.svg b/client/icons/position-top-right.svg new file mode 100644 index 000000000..4e998b4be --- /dev/null +++ b/client/icons/position-top-right.svg @@ -0,0 +1 @@ + \ No newline at end of file diff --git a/scripts/buildHomebrew.js b/scripts/buildHomebrew.js index 5bed5bf78..a6120b144 100644 --- a/scripts/buildHomebrew.js +++ b/scripts/buildHomebrew.js @@ -97,6 +97,7 @@ fs.emptyDirSync('./build'); // Move assets await fs.copy('./themes/fonts', './build/fonts'); await fs.copy('./themes/assets', './build/assets'); + await fs.copy('./client/icons', './build/icons'); //v==----------------------------- BUNDLE PACKAGES --------------------------------==v//